How Do I Boost Subscriber Interaction in Youtube Comments?
1. Create Engaging and Thought-Provoking Content
Content is the foundation of interaction. When your videos are interesting, informative, or entertaining, viewers are more inclined to leave comments. To encourage discussion:
- Ask open-ended questions: End your videos with questions like, "What do you think about this topic?" or "How would you handle this situation?"
- Share personal stories or experiences: Invite viewers to share their own related stories in the comments.
- Use compelling thumbnails and titles: Curiosity-driven titles and visuals can increase engagement and prompt viewers to comment.
Example: If you create cooking tutorials, ask viewers which ingredient they would substitute or what dish they want to see next.
2. Respond to Comments and Foster Conversations
Active engagement from the creator encourages viewers to participate more. When subscribers see their comments acknowledged, they feel valued and are more likely to continue commenting. To do this effectively:
- Reply promptly and thoughtfully: Address questions, thank commenters for their input, and add value to the discussion.
- Pin the best or most relevant comments: Highlight insightful or humorous comments to encourage others to contribute similar insights.
- Ask follow-up questions in your replies: This keeps the conversation going and deepens engagement.
Example: If a viewer asks for advice on a product review, reply with personalized recommendations and ask if they have tried similar products.
3. Use Calls-to-Action (CTAs) Effectively
Encourage viewers to comment by including clear and compelling CTAs in your videos and descriptions. Some effective techniques include:
- Directly ask viewers to comment: Phrases like "Let me know your thoughts in the comments below" or "Share your experience with this topic."
- Pose specific questions: Instead of generic prompts, ask targeted questions related to your content.
- Incentivize commenting: Run comment-based giveaways or ask viewers to share their ideas for future videos.
Example: "Comment below with your favorite tip for staying productive, and I might feature your comment in the next video!"
4. Incorporate Community Features and Tools
YouTube offers several features designed to foster community interaction beyond just comments. Utilize these tools to create a more engaging environment:
- Community Tab: Post polls, images, and updates to encourage interaction outside of video comments.
- Live chats: Host live streams with real-time comment engagement, Q&A sessions, or behind-the-scenes content.
- Comment pinned posts: Use pinned comments to highlight questions or prompts that encourage viewers to comment.
Example: Conduct a poll on your Community Tab asking viewers what content they'd like to see next, then discuss the results in your comments.
5. Consistently Post Content and Maintain a Schedule
Regular posting keeps your audience engaged and increases opportunities for interaction. When viewers see consistent uploads, they are more likely to comment and participate actively. To optimize this:
- Create a posting schedule: Notify your audience when to expect new videos.
- Encourage comments after each upload: Remind viewers to share their thoughts or questions in the comments section.
- Engage in the comments of your previous videos: This shows ongoing interest and encourages viewers to comment on newer videos.
Example: If you post weekly tutorials, remind viewers at the end of each video to leave feedback or suggestions for next week’s content.
6. Leverage Collaborations and Community Engagement
Partnering with other creators or engaging with your community can amplify comment activity:
- Collaborate with other YouTubers: Cross-promote and encourage each other's audiences to comment and share feedback.
- Feature viewer comments: Highlight or respond to interesting comments from your subscribers in your videos.
- Create challenges or prompts: Invite viewers to participate in specific discussion topics or challenges, increasing comment volume.
Example: Run a "Subscriber Spotlight" series where you feature and respond to comments from your loyal viewers.
7. Monitor and Analyze Comment Trends
Understanding what drives engagement can help you refine your strategy. Use YouTube Analytics and comment moderation tools to:
- Identify popular topics or questions: Focus on these areas in future content and prompts.
- Detect and remove spam or negative comments: Maintaining a positive environment encourages genuine interaction.
- Track engagement patterns: See which videos generate the most comments and why.
Example: Noticing that videos with Q&A prompts receive more comments allows you to incorporate similar strategies in upcoming videos.

Top 25 Facts About Life
1. Life Is Full Of Uncertainty And Change
Life is inherently unpredictable. Circumstances, relationships, and opportunities can change at any moment. Embracing uncertainty allows us to adapt, grow, and develop resilience. Accepting change as part of life helps reduce stress, build confidence, and discover new possibilities that would otherwise remain hidden.
2. Small Daily Habits Have Big Impacts
Our daily actions compound over time. Simple habits like reading, exercising, eating healthily, or practicing gratitude can significantly influence mental, physical, and emotional well-being. Life is shaped less by grand gestures than by consistent, mindful behaviors repeated every day, which eventually form our character and future.
3. Perspective Shapes Experience
The way we perceive events determines our emotional response. A single situation can be seen as a challenge, a lesson, or a setback depending on perspective. Cultivating a positive and growth-oriented mindset allows us to navigate life more smoothly, find opportunities in adversity, and maintain emotional balance.
4. Relationships Are Central To Happiness
Human connection plays a vital role in overall well-being. Strong relationships with family, friends, or community provide support, love, and shared experiences. Prioritizing meaningful connections, effective communication, and empathy contributes to emotional fulfillment and resilience throughout the ups and downs of life.
5. Lifelong Learning Enhances Growth
Life is an ongoing journey of knowledge and discovery. Curiosity, continuous learning, and skill development expand our understanding of the world and ourselves. Lifelong learning encourages creativity, adaptability, and personal fulfillment, helping us remain engaged and capable in a rapidly changing society.
6. Health Is A Foundation For Everything
Physical, mental, and emotional health are the pillars of a fulfilling life. Regular exercise, balanced nutrition, sufficient sleep, and stress management empower us to perform daily activities, pursue goals, and enjoy meaningful experiences. Without health, even the most successful ambitions can feel limited or unsustainable.
7. Failure Is Part Of Growth
Mistakes and failures are inevitable, yet essential for development. They provide insights, resilience, and opportunities to improve. Viewing failure as a teacher rather than a setback fosters courage, creativity, and perseverance. Life’s most valuable lessons often come from our missteps rather than our successes.
8. Gratitude Improves Well-Being
Practicing gratitude shifts focus from what is lacking to what is abundant. Recognizing small joys, achievements, and relationships enhances mood, reduces stress, and strengthens emotional health. Gratitude encourages optimism, empathy, and a sense of connection, making life feel richer and more meaningful.
9. Time Is Life’s Most Precious Resource
Unlike money or material possessions, time is finite. How we spend each moment shapes our experiences, memories, and legacy. Prioritizing meaningful activities, relationships, and self-care ensures a more fulfilling life. Conscious management of time can increase happiness, productivity, and long-term satisfaction.
10. Mindfulness Brings Clarity
Being fully present in each moment helps us experience life more deeply. Mindfulness improves focus, reduces stress, and enhances emotional regulation. By paying attention to thoughts, feelings, and surroundings without judgment, we cultivate awareness that guides decisions and fosters peace and contentment.
11. Kindness Has Ripple Effects
Acts of kindness, no matter how small, create positive effects that extend beyond the immediate moment. Helping others improves our own mood and strengthens social bonds. Generosity fosters empathy, cooperation, and community, contributing to a life that feels purposeful and connected.
12. Adaptability Determines Success
Life rarely follows a rigid plan. The ability to adapt to changing circumstances, expectations, or environments is essential for personal growth and achievement. Flexibility allows us to seize opportunities, recover from setbacks, and navigate complexity with resilience and confidence.
13. Self-Reflection Drives Improvement
Regular reflection on thoughts, actions, and decisions fosters self-awareness. Understanding our strengths, weaknesses, and motivations enables better choices, stronger relationships, and personal development. Life becomes more intentional when we evaluate progress, learn from experiences, and adjust behavior accordingly.
14. Money Can Enhance But Not Guarantee Happiness
Financial stability supports comfort, health, and access to opportunities. However, material wealth alone does not guarantee long-term fulfillment. True happiness stems from meaningful relationships, purpose, personal growth, and experiences. Balancing financial goals with emotional and social well-being is key to a satisfying life.
15. Nature Benefits Mind And Body
Spending time in natural environments reduces stress, improves focus, and fosters creativity. Nature provides perspective, calm, and physical health benefits. Engaging with outdoor activities or simply observing natural surroundings enhances overall well-being and strengthens our connection to the world around us.
16. Patience Cultivates Resilience
Life often unfolds in unpredictable ways. Developing patience allows us to manage frustration, delay gratification, and endure challenges without unnecessary stress. Resilience grows when we accept that meaningful achievements, relationships, and personal growth require time and consistent effort.
17. Humor Lightens Life’s Burdens
Laughter provides physical, mental, and social benefits. Humor relieves stress, improves perspective, and strengthens bonds with others. Being able to find lightness in adversity fosters resilience, optimism, and emotional well-being, helping navigate life’s challenges with a healthier outlook.
18. Purpose Creates Direction
Having a sense of purpose guides choices, motivates action, and gives meaning to everyday life. Purpose can be derived from work, relationships, personal goals, or service to others. A clear sense of why we do what we do enhances fulfillment, resilience, and long-term satisfaction.
19. Emotions Are Guides, Not Enemies
Emotions provide valuable information about our needs, values, and surroundings. Instead of suppressing feelings, observing and understanding them helps us make conscious decisions. Emotional intelligence allows for healthier relationships, improved problem-solving, and a more authentic and meaningful life.
20. Learning From Others Accelerates Growth
Observing, listening, and seeking guidance from mentors, peers, or historical examples allows us to avoid mistakes and gain wisdom faster. Collaboration and shared knowledge expand perspectives, encourage innovation, and strengthen social bonds, enriching the journey of life significantly.
21. Simplicity Reduces Stress
Simplifying life, whether through decluttering, prioritizing, or reducing commitments, can improve mental clarity and emotional balance. Focusing on essentials, meaningful work, and genuine relationships fosters contentment. Minimalism and intentional living reduce overwhelm, making it easier to appreciate life’s small joys.
22. Resilience Is Built Over Time
Facing challenges repeatedly and learning to cope strengthens resilience. Each difficulty, failure, or disappointment provides an opportunity to develop grit and endurance. Resilient individuals bounce back from adversity, maintain optimism, and continue to pursue goals despite setbacks, creating a more empowered and confident life.
23. Curiosity Keeps Life Vibrant
A curious mind seeks knowledge, exploration, and new experiences. Curiosity encourages creativity, adaptability, and joy in everyday life. Lifelong curiosity fosters personal growth, deepens understanding of the world, and keeps life dynamic, engaging, and full of opportunities for discovery.
24. Balance Is Essential For Well-Being
Balancing work, relationships, rest, and personal pursuits prevents burnout and promotes holistic well-being. Life requires attention to mental, emotional, and physical health. Prioritizing balance allows for sustainable success, satisfaction, and meaningful engagement across all areas of life.
25. Life Is About Growth, Not Perfection
Striving for perfection can lead to stress and disappointment. Life is a journey of continuous growth, learning, and self-improvement. Embracing imperfection allows us to take risks, explore creativity, and cultivate resilience. Personal progress, not flawlessness, is the true measure of a fulfilling life.
